. This letter is written to request NRC assessment of the SBWR Test and Analysis Program as documented in Reference 1, discussed with NRC in the Reference 2 meeting, and discussed with both ACRS and NRC in the Reference 3 meeting.

Specifically we request NRC concurrence that if the TRACG qualiGcation plan described in Section 6 and test programs described in Appendix A are accomplished with no major surprises, it will be possible to conclude that the provisions of 10CFR52.47 (b) (2) (i) (A) (1), (2), and (3) have been satisfied; and agreement with our conclusion that the Program will succeca With56t16nstruction of a new mtcgrai'

~

systems test facility.
